Upcoming Market Updates: NZD, JPY, AUD, GBP, CHF, EUR, USD

NZD: Building Consents m/m, it measures Change in the number of new building approvals issued.

JPY: Unemployment Rate, it measures Percentage of the total work force that is unemployed and actively seeking employment during the previous month.

JPY: Prelim Industrial Production m/m, it measures Change in the total inflation-adjusted value of output produced by manufacturers, mines, and utilities.

JPY: Retail Sales y/y, it measures Change in the total value of sales at the retail level.

AUD: Private Sector Credit m/m, it measures Change in the total value of new credit issued to consumers and businesses.

JPY: Consumer Confidence, it measures Level of a composite index based on surveyed households, excluding single-person homes.

JPY: Housing Starts y/y, it measures Change in the number of new residential buildings that began construction.

GBP: Current Account, it measures Difference in value between imported and exported goods, services, income flows, and unilateral transfers during the previous quarter.

GBP: Final GDP q/q, it measures Change in the inflation-adjusted value of all goods and services produced by the economy.

GBP: Nationwide HPI m/m, it measures Change in the selling price of homes with mortgages backed by Nationwide.

GBP: Revised Business Investment q/q, it measures Change in the total inflation-adjusted value of capital investments made by businesses and the government.

CHF: Retail Sales y/y, it measures Change in the total value of inflation-adjusted sales at the retail level, excluding automobiles and gas stations.

EUR: French Consumer Spending m/m, it measures Change in the inflation-adjusted value of all goods expenditures by consumers.

EUR: French Prelim CPI m/m, it measures Change in the price of goods and services purchased by consumers.

CHF: KOF Economic Barometer, it measures Level of a composite index based on 219 economic indicators.

EUR: German Unemployment Change, it measures Change in the number of unemployed people during the previous month.

EUR: Italian Monthly, it measures Percentage of the total work force that is unemployed and actively seeking employment during the previous month.

GBP: M4 Money Supply m/m, it measures Change in the total quantity of domestic currency in circulation and deposited in banks.

GBP: Mortgage Approvals, it measures Number of new mortgages approved for home purchases during the previous month.

GBP: Net Lending to Individuals m/m, it measures Change in the total value of new credit issued to consumers.

EUR: CPI Flash Estimate y/y, it measures Change in the price of goods and services purchased by consumers.

EUR: Core CPI Flash Estimate y/y, it measures Change in the price of goods and services purchased by consumers, excluding food, energy, alcohol, and tobacco.

EUR: Italian Prelim CPI m/m, it measures Change in the price of goods and services purchased by consumers.

EUR: Unemployment Rate, it measures Percentage of the total work force that is unemployed and actively seeking employment during the previous month.

USD: Core PCE Price Index m/m, it measures Change in the price of goods and services purchased by consumers, excluding food and energy.

USD: Personal Income m/m, it measures Change in the total value of income received from all sources by consumers.

USD: Personal Spending m/m, it measures Change in the inflation-adjusted value of all expenditures by consumers.
